Is coinminer a fileless cryptocurrency miner?

Could you elaborate on whether coinminer is a fileless cryptocurrency miner? The term "fileless" typically suggests the presence of malicious activity that does not rely on traditional executable files for execution. In the context of cryptocurrency mining, fileless miners can be especially stealthy as they may operate directly in memory, avoiding detection by traditional antivirus software. Understanding whether coinminer operates in this manner is crucial for identifying and mitigating potential security risks. Could you provide further details on how coinminer functions and whether it fits the definition of a fileless miner?
